The responsibilities of the Program Director are to provide leadership and supervision to a program serving adults who are seeking to gain the skills for independent living and who have a psychiatric diagnosis. Duties include:

  • Program oversight including all service provision including evaluation of client referrals, client admission, communication and collaboration with service providers and family members, oversee service provisions that are client centered.
  • Administrations of Medicaid billable services, regulatory compliance, oversee the group home is safe and comfortable, and oversee the program budget.
  • Staff training and development, leadership, and supervision of 6 staff members including one Assistant Program Director, in addition shared on-call for staff for Emmanuel House only.
  • Oversight to ensuring the group home is maintained in a safe and healthy manner with the assistance of the clients and the team.
  • The Program Director is located at the group home and provides direct services to the clients. The Program Director mentors staff members in providing client-centered services by role modeling and teaching.

Requirements

Skills/Qualifications for the Program Director include:

  • Bachelor’s degree in a human services discipline and one year experience in mental health, or associate degree in human services and three years’ experience in mental health or high school diploma and five years’ experience in mental health,
  • 1 year’s supervisory experience,
  • Valid and insurable driver's licenses as agency vehicles are available for business use,
  • Experience with electronic records preferred,
  • Experience or education in crisis intervention and prevention preferred,
  • Strong leadership ability,
  • Excellent communication skills both verbal and written, and
  • The ability to be organized, multitask, and have good time management skills.
